Show DENVER, June 16. Attorneys for Mrs. John W Springer, wife of the president of the Continental Trust company of this city, today admitted that summonses in a divorce action had beon served on their client two weeks ago at Chicago, where she had gone immediately after the shooting of S. Louis (Tony) Von Phul, the SL Louis balloonist, by Frank II Hen-wood Hen-wood In a hotel bar room here May 24. Letters From Mrs. Springer. Mrs Springer's name was coupled with the killing of Von Phul and it Is declared that letters from Mrs. Sprlng-or Sprlng-or to Von Phul. which were found among Von Phul's effects when tho district attorney's office took charge of them, form the basis of the divorce action Mrs. Springer rerurned to Donver about a week ago. supposedly to effect ef-fect a reconciliation with her husband Upon her arrival here. Mr. Springer departed A number of conferences have been held between the attorneys of both sides, but so far as known without result May Be Called as Witness. Whilp attorneys for Hcuwood decline de-cline to discuss tlio matter it Is not improbable that Mrs Springer will he called as a witness for the defense when Ilcnwood is brought to trial for the killing of Von Phul. Henwood will be brought to trial next Monday on a charge of murder for the killing of George Copeland, a Cripple fV Colorado, smelter owner, who wab hit by bullets fired at Von Phul by Hen-wood Hen-wood and who died later from his wounds. |
